LES PLUS BEAUX CONTES DE PERRAULT.

Author: Charles PERRAULT
Illustrations: Monique GORDE
All scans by me



Cendrillon (Cinderella)



Le petit chaperon rouge (Little Red Riding Hood)



Le petit poucet (Little Thumb or Hop o' My Thumb)



La belle au bois dormant (Sleeping Beauty)



Peau d'Âne (Donkeyskin)...my favorite :)







Barbe Bleu (Bluebeard)



Les Fées (The Fairies or Diamonds and Toads)



La belle aux cheveux d'or par Madame d'AULNOY
(The Story of Pretty Goldilocks or The Beauty with Golden Hair, by Madame d'Aulnoy)
Note: Madame d'Aulnoy was the one to coied the term Conte de Fées (fairy tales) in France (in the French Salons) aound the 1690's
